Where do these ideas come from?  How long does it take for them to mature?

Ideas are running around in my head all the time!!  Some are ready to go, but many are in production.  My picture “Caught in the Light” was an idea under production for 2 years!!

I had a great picture of a barn owl my sister had given me 2 years ago but did not know how I wanted to present him.  He has percolated in my mind waiting for his spot.  Then this spring I found it!

I was doing a photography trip up in the Harrison Mills area when I came across this interesting tree by the water.  I loved the gnarled roots that had lost their support but still stood firm in the water.  They were my inspiration for my owl.  “Caught in the Light” was soon underway.
